2007-08 Marietta College men's basketball preview
Pioneers return four lettermen this winter

Nov. 12, 2007
MARIETTA, Ohio — The Marietta College men's basketball team begins a new era in 2007-08, as first-year Head Coach Jon VanderWal, a 2001 graduate of Albion (Mich.) College, takes over the program's reins after spending the last four years as an assistant coach at Ohio Wesleyan.

The Pioneers return four lettermen but just one starter, junior All-Ohio Athletic Conference (OAC) guard Isaiah Creasap, from the 2006-07 squad. The veterans were joined in camp by 15 newcomers, many of who will be asked to contribute immediately.

Creasap, who averaged 14.4 points, 1.6 assists and 1.6 rebounds, was the top three-point shooter in the OAC last season, hitting 89-of-204 (.436) from long range. The co-captain also ranked tenth in scoring.

As a young team, Marietta will look for senior center Adam Rockhold to step up this season. Rockhold, a co-captain, averaged 3.8 points and 3.2 rebounds in 15.5 minutes off the bench during his junior year.

The Pioneers open the season against the host Bullets at the Gettysburg (Pa.) College Tournament November 16. Marietta will then travel to Meadville, Pa., for Allegheny College's National City Tip-off Tournament November 24-25. The team's home opener is slated for November 28 versus Franciscan. The Pioneers open OAC play at Ohio Northern December 1 and will host the Marietta Shrine Classic December 29-30 at Ban Johnson Arena. Alumni Day will take place during Winter Weekend on February 16, when Marietta takes on John Carroll.

Here is a closer look at the Pioneers by position:

Point Guard: Sophomore Jordan Johnson is the early favorite to run the point for the Pioneers in 2007-08. Johnson, who will also see time at the wing, came off the bench in 20 games and averaged 2.5 points last year. Freshman Jordan Cox has emerged as someone ready to contribute immediately and will assist in the point guard duties. Freshmen Blaine Carey, Jay Chadwell and Donnie Jenkins are also competing for minutes at the point.

Wing: Junior All-OAC sharpshooter Isaiah Creasap returns at one of the wing positions this season. Creasap, who averages 11.6 points over his 50-game career, has hit a three-point field goal in 48 of those contests. In addition to ranking 10th in scoring, he finished last season ranked first in the OAC in three-point field goals made and fifth in three-point percentage. Juniors Andrew Good, who returns after not playing in 2006-07, and Mike Stanek also return with in-game experience, while newcomers Jay Chadwell, Nate Edick, Jarel Floyd, Justin Floyd, Donnie Jenkins, Ronnie Jenkins, Matt Kubachka and Chip Strock will battle for time at the wing this season.

Post: Senior center Adam Rockhold jumps into a starting role in the paint for the Pioneers this winter. Averaging 2.8 points and 2.8 rebounds over his career, he will be expected to be a presence down low on both sides of the ball. Four new additions—Bradley Hinton, Matt Levitt, Matt Kubachka and Daun Lutes—are also expected to contribute at the post in 2007-08.
